The Economic and Financial Crimes Commission (EFCC) has set its sights on eight Ministers within President Muhammadu Buhari’s cabinet in an ongoing investigation into alleged financial misconduct.
It was gathered from a reliable source within the EFCC that these ministers are being scrutinized for potential involvement in fraudulent activities, misappropriation of public funds, and abuse of office. While the specific details of the allegations have not been disclosed, it is believed that the investigations are centered around suspicious financial transactions and irregularities within their respective ministries.
